What sets fruit and vegetable packing machines apart from others?

2025/05/10

Handling fruits and vegetables during the packing process requires precision and care to ensure that the produce remains fresh and intact by the time it reaches consumers. This is where fruit and vegetable packing machines come into play, offering a variety of features and technologies that set them apart from other types of packaging equipment. In this article, we will delve into what makes these machines unique and essential for the food industry.

Increased Efficiency and Productivity

One of the primary reasons why fruit and vegetable packing machines stand out is their ability to significantly increase efficiency and productivity in the packing process. These machines are designed to handle large quantities of produce quickly and accurately, minimizing the need for manual labor and reducing the risk of human error. By automating the packing process, companies can maximize output while maintaining consistent quality standards.

Modern packing machines are equipped with advanced technologies such as sensors, cameras, and computerized systems that can sort, grade, and package fruits and vegetables with precision. Some machines can even detect defects or foreign objects in the produce and remove them before packaging, ensuring that only high-quality products are sent to market. This level of automation not only speeds up the packing process but also reduces the overall cost of production by cutting down on waste and rework.

Customizable Packaging Options

Another key feature that sets fruit and vegetable packing machines apart is their ability to offer customizable packaging options to meet the specific needs of different products and markets. These machines can be tailored to pack produce in various formats, including trays, bags, boxes, and pouches, allowing companies to showcase their products in the most appealing and convenient way possible.

Furthermore, packing machines can be equipped with different weighing and counting systems to ensure that each package contains the correct amount of produce. This level of customization is essential for companies that offer a wide range of fruit and vegetable products and need flexibility in their packaging solutions to cater to different customer demands.

Improved Quality and Shelf Life

Quality control is a crucial aspect of the packing process, especially when handling perishable fruits and vegetables. Fruit and vegetable packing machines are designed to maintain the freshness and quality of produce throughout the packaging process, ensuring that the final products reach consumers in optimal condition.

These machines can be equipped with features such as temperature control, moisture regulation, and protective packaging materials to extend the shelf life of fruits and vegetables. By creating an ideal environment for the produce during packing, companies can minimize spoilage and reduce the risk of contamination, ultimately preserving the quality and taste of the product for a longer period.

Hygiene and Food Safety Compliance

Maintaining high standards of hygiene and food safety is a top priority for food manufacturers, especially when handling fresh produce. Fruit and vegetable packing machines are designed with cleanliness and sanitation in mind, with features that facilitate easy cleaning and sterilization to prevent contamination.

Many packing machines are made of food-grade stainless steel and other materials that are resistant to corrosion and bacteria, ensuring that the produce remains free from harmful pathogens and contaminants. Additionally, these machines often come with built-in sanitation systems that use UV light, ozone, or other methods to sterilize the equipment and packaging materials before use, further reducing the risk of foodborne illnesses.

Cost-Effectiveness and Sustainability

In addition to their operational efficiency and product quality benefits, fruit and vegetable packing machines are also a cost-effective and sustainable solution for food manufacturers. By automating the packing process, companies can reduce labor costs, minimize product loss, and optimize production efficiency, leading to overall cost savings in the long run.

Furthermore, packing machines are designed to use eco-friendly materials and packaging formats that are recyclable or biodegradable, helping companies reduce their environmental footprint and comply with sustainability regulations. By investing in modern packing machines, companies can enhance their reputation as environmentally responsible businesses while also reducing waste and contributing to a more sustainable food supply chain.

In conclusion, fruit and vegetable packing machines offer a wide range of features and technologies that set them apart from other types of packaging equipment. From increased efficiency and productivity to customizable packaging options, improved quality and shelf life, hygiene and food safety compliance, and cost-effectiveness and sustainability, these machines play a crucial role in ensuring that fresh produce reaches consumers in optimal condition. By investing in the right packing machine for their specific needs, food manufacturers can streamline their operations, enhance product quality, and ultimately gain a competitive edge in the market.
